What Does Deliver Order on Fiverr Mean?

If you're dipping your toes into the freelancing world or looking for specific services, you might have stumbled upon Fiverr. But what does "Deliver Order" mean in this context? This term is a crucial part of the Fiverr experience, especially if you’re a buyer or a seller. It represents the moment when a seller completes and submits their service to the buyer. It’s a significant step in the transaction, and understanding it can enhance your experience on this platform. Let’s dive deeper into Fiverr and how its marketplace operates!

What is an Order on Fiverr?

When we talk about an "order" on Fiverr, we're diving into the core of what makes this platform tick. Fiverr is a bustling marketplace where freelancers offer services—known as gigs—to clients around the globe. When you place an order on Fiverr, you're essentially entering a transaction where you purchase a specific service from a seller. Here’s how it typically works:

  • Choosing a Gig: First, you browse through thousands of gigs tailored to your needs. Whether you're looking for graphic design, writing, programming, or voice-over work, Fiverr offers plenty of options.
  • Customization: After selecting a gig, most sellers allow you to customize your order. This could involve specifying certain details, choosing from different packages, or adding extra services for an additional fee.
  • Making Payment: Once you’re happy with the gig details, you'll proceed to checkout, where you complete a secure payment. Remember, Fiverr holds the payment until the order is successfully delivered.
  • Seller's Responsibility: After receiving your order, the seller is responsible for delivering the service as per the agreement, usually within a set timeframe.

In essence, an order on Fiverr represents a mutual agreement between the buyer and seller, establishing expectations about the work to be done, the timelines involved, and the payment for that work. Sounds pretty straightforward, right?

How to Deliver an Order on Fiverr

Delivering an order on Fiverr is a crucial step in ensuring that both you and your client are satisfied with the final product. The delivery process is fairly straightforward, but it’s essential to follow the correct steps to keep everything organized and professional.

Here’s how you can effectively deliver an order on Fiverr:

  1. Complete the Work: Make sure that you’ve fulfilled all the requirements stated in the order. This includes following the client's instructions, incorporating any feedback received during the process, and ensuring that the quality meets or exceeds expectations.
  2. Prepare Your Delivery: Create a delivery file that can be easily understood and accessed by your client. This may include PDFs, images, or other file types depending on the nature of your service. If you’re providing a digital product, ensure the file size is manageable and the format is appropriate.
  3. Utilize the Delivery Button: Once your work is ready, go to your Fiverr account dashboard, find the specific order under the 'Orders' section, and click on the ‘Deliver Order’ button. This will take you to a form where you can upload your files.
  4. Add a Personal Note: It’s always nice to include a short message to your client. This could be a thank you note or an outline of what you’ve delivered. Personal touches go a long way!
  5. Submit the Delivery: Double-check everything and then click the ‘Deliver Order’ button. Your client will then receive a notification that their order is ready for review.

And that's it! You've successfully delivered an order on Fiverr.

Common Issues Related to Order Delivery

When using platforms like Fiverr for freelance services, many buyers and sellers encounter a few common issues related to order delivery. Understanding these can help ensure a smoother transaction experience. Here are some of the most frequent challenges:

  • Delayed Delivery: One of the major concerns is receiving the order later than the expected deadline. Freelancers may face unforeseen circumstances such as personal emergencies or excessive workloads.
  • Quality Issues: Sometimes, the delivered work may not meet the quality standards promised in the gig description. This can lead to dissatisfaction and requests for revisions.
  • Miscommunication: Misunderstandings regarding project requirements can lead to incorrect deliveries. Clear communication is essential to ensure both parties are on the same page.
  • Technical Issues: Occasionally, tech hiccups can occur, especially if large files are involved. For instance, files might not upload correctly or may be corrupted during the transfer.
  • Feedback Delay: After the order is delivered, buyers may take time to leave feedback, which can impact the seller’s rating and potential for future work.

To mitigate these issues, both buyers and sellers should have open lines of communication. Setting clear expectations from the start and being transparent about timelines and capabilities can help in avoiding these common pitfalls.
